
Giza governorate has signed a cooperation protocol with the Slum Development Fund, which is affiliated to the Cabinet, to develop six slum areas in the governorate.
Giza Governor Kamal el Daly and Housing Minister Mostafa Madbouli signed the protocol.
The infrastructure in the six slum areas will be also developed along with the road pavement and lighting, Daly said.
All services related to health and education will also be provided, he added.
The housing minister, meanwhile, said that the move came as part of efforts to solve the slum areas problem.
"We aim to eradicate slum areas nationwide within two years and a half," he added.
Local Development Minister Ahmed Zaki Badr, meanwhile, said that all slum areas throughout Egypt will be eradicated through short-term, medium-term and long-term plans.
